Strong Price Momentum Drives New Peak
On 31 Dec 2025, S. V. J. Enterprises Ltd recorded a day change of 3.47%, outperforming the Sensex’s 0.61% gain on the same day. Despite touching an intraday low of Rs 487, down 4.93%, the stock closed higher, maintaining its position above all key moving averages – 5 day, 20 day, 50 day, 100 day, and 200 day. This technical strength underscores the stock’s robust upward trajectory.
The stock’s performance over various time frames highlights its exceptional rally. Over the past three months, it surged by 146.51%, vastly outpacing the Sensex’s 5.20% gain. The one-year performance is even more striking, with a 226.86% increase compared to the Sensex’s 9.03%. Year-to-date, the stock has matched this 226.86% rise, signalling consistent growth throughout the year.
Sector and Market Context
Operating within the Paper, Forest & Jute Products sector, S. V. J. Enterprises Ltd’s recent gains contrast with the sector’s underperformance today, where the stock underperformed the sector by -5.86%. This divergence highlights the company’s unique position and resilience amid broader sector fluctuations.
While the Sensex has delivered moderate returns over the past year and beyond, the stock’s extraordinary gains have set it apart as a standout performer. However, it is notable that over longer horizons such as three, five, and ten years, the stock shows no recorded performance, whereas the Sensex has delivered 40.03%, 78.41%, and 226.19% respectively. This suggests that the recent rally is a relatively new phenomenon in the company’s market history.

Technical Strength and Moving Averages
The stock’s position above all major moving averages is a key technical indicator of its strength. Trading above the 5 day, 20 day, 50 day, 100 day, and 200 day averages suggests sustained buying interest and a bullish trend. This technical setup often attracts momentum traders and can support further price stability at elevated levels.
Such alignment across multiple moving averages is relatively rare and typically signals a well-established uptrend. It also provides a framework for analysing potential support levels should the stock experience short-term corrections.
